In 2001, New Jersey construction company MZM Construction Company hired workers from a local labor union for a construction project at Newark International Airport. From 2001 to 2018, MZM made more than $500,000 in contributions to the Funds for MZM’s work at the Newark International Airport (which MZM completed in 2004) and other projects.
